Popular 3D Game Development Tools

Unity: A Versatile Platform

Unity is a powerful platform for 3D game development, known for its versatility and user-friendly interface. It supports multiple platforms, allowing developers to reach a broader audience. This can enhance potential revenue streams.

The asset store provides a wealth of resources, including pre-made models and scripts. This reduces development time and costs. Many developers appreciate this efficiency.

Additionally, Unity’s robust community offers support and resources. Collaboration can lead to innovative solutions. Engaging with this community is beneficial. Unity’s flexibility makes it suitable for various projects. It adapts to different creative visions.

Unreal Engine: Power and Realism

Unreal Engine is renowned for its power and realism in 3D game development. It offers advanced graphics capabilities, enabling developers to create visually stunning environments. This can significantly enhance user engagement.

Moreover, the engine supports high-fidelity rendering, which is crucial for realistic simulations. This feature attracts developers focused on immersive experiences. Many professionals prefer this level of detail.

Additionally, Unreal Engine provides a comprehensive suite of tools for animation and physics. These tools streamline the development process and improve efficiency. Collaboration within teams becomes easier. The extensive documentation and community support further enhance its usability. Engaging with this community is essential.

Godot: Open Source Innovation

Godot is an open-source game development platform that fosters innovation and creativity. It allows developers to create 2D and 3D games without licensing fees. This can significantly reduce overall project costs.

He appreciates the flexibility of Godot’s scripting language, GDScript, which is designed for ease of use. This accessibility encourages experimentation and rapid prototyping. Many developers find this beneficial.

Additionally, Godot’s active community contributes to its continuous improvement. He can access a wealth of resources and reenforcement. This collaboration enhances the development experience. The platform’s modular architecture allows for tailored solutions. It adapts to specific project needs .
